Early Experiences with the Endovascular Repair of Ruptured Descending Thoracic Aortic Aneurysm
BACKGROUND: The aim of this study was to report our early experiences with the endovascular repair of ruptured descending thoracic aortic aneurysms (rDTAAs), which are a rare and life-threatening condition.
